Total Produce announces 13% rise in pre-tax profits
Fruit distributor Total Produce has reported a 13% rise in pre-tax profits to €22m for the first half of this year as compared to the same period last year.
Revenue went up 6% to just below €1.3bn.
Chairman Carl McCann said the rise in profits was due to acquisitions and tight control over costs.
The company said the boost from acquisitions was partly offset by the euro's strength against sterling.
